In anticipation of the new natural gas pipeline to Mazatlán slated to be operational in 2016, several companies located in the Bonfil Industrial Park contracted to install distribution lines to their locations and report the project is fifty percent completed.
The companies with forethought which hired Gas Natural Industrial SA de CV to install the pipes include Pescados Industrializados SA de CV, Café El Marino, Bimbo and Pacífico Beer.
The next order of business, said the industrial park’s administrator Francisco Castillo López, is to petition the municipal government to direct the Torreón contractor to acquire an insurance policy against hidden risks. According to the contractor’s certificate, the company is required to maintain and protect the lines for only six months after completion of the project.
